Luxury vehicle makers have a way of upping the ante, with features that seem more and more unique, opulent and, perhaps, unnecessary.

When INFINITI recently unveiled its newest QX65 SUV, it led with the vehicle’s unorthodox paint color: dubbed Sunfire Red, this coating is described by the company as “something people will remember.”

That’s because the rich paint hue, inspired by a "fiery morning sunrise” is said to be “infused with real gold-coated glass flecks.”

INFINITI’s design team described the requirements of working with this very special paint, noting that INFINITI’s supplier must use armored trucks when transporting the gold that’s used in the making of Sunfire Red.
